What is the difference between the PRO and FASTA Jersey? 

The PRO Jersey is a ‘club’ fitting jersey, meaning it is more relaxed than the FASTA option. The FASTA jersey is a close-fitting / high-end jersey.

What is the difference between the PRO and FASTA Shorts? 

The fit between the two are similar, but the fabrics on the FASTA are more premium. The FASTA shorts also feature a seamless gripper (for comfort). Both pads are medium density, medium thickness pads – but the fit of the pad on the FASTA shorts allows you to be more comfortable when in an aerodynamic position.
